It is the ecological interaction between two or more species where each species is benefitted from the other. It is the most common type of ecological interaction and describes that mutual dependence is necessary for social well-being. It is dominant in most communities worldwide. Also Read: Mutualism See more This is a type of ecological interaction where one organism is benefitted from the other organism without harming or benefitting it. For eg., cattle egrets and livestock, birds following army ants, barnacles and whales, … See more Parasitism is a one-sided symbiosis, where one organism lives on or in another organism.
